Transaction 3410beacf71bd26cb263b21658656e952d2531407385373913d2d3ca41a193c8

1 Input
2 Outputs
  • 3410beacf71bd26cb263b21658656e952d2531407385373913d2d3ca41a193c8:0
  • value  871293
    address  17hJSckSUTfDhadoqFhVnBeusq8x5EqpN
  • 3410beacf71bd26cb263b21658656e952d2531407385373913d2d3ca41a193c8:1
  • value  546420
    address  1DAcKqnrPK73SCGrgvjAG3aubHcu1rFSux